Oil and oil filter
Plugs
Fuel filter
Coolant
Clean the filter if you already have a K&N
Check the Dizzy cap and rotor button and replace if necessary. Same with the plugs and wires I suppose.
Maybe just do a check of things like tyres, suspension bushings, worn shocks and sagging springs.

not much, but be sure the filter has the valve Mazda rotary filters need - they get put upside down in relation to other filters, and the oil could drain out when parked without the valve - leading to oil starvation on startup
